About Kingsport, Tennessee

Kingsport unfolds within a valley cupped by the Appalachian Mountains, its landscape shaped by the meandering Holston River and the rolling terrain of Sullivan County. It lies 5.8 miles east-south-east of Marshall, TN (from Marshall, TN: bearing 107°T), and is situated 4.7 miles west-south-west of Bloomingdale. This region's history is deeply entwined with the natural bounty of the land, from early Cherokee settlements to the arrival of pioneers drawn by fertile soil and abundant timber. The economy of Kingsport, historically rooted in agriculture and mining, has evolved to embrace industrial innovation, particularly in the manufacturing sectors, which have provided a steady pulse to the community, often bathed in the hazy, soft light that characterizes these mountain mornings. The very air here can carry the scent of pine and damp earth, a constant reminder of the surrounding wildness that frames the more ordered life of the city. The cultural character of Kingsport reflects a blend of Southern hospitality and a pragmatic, forward-looking spirit, evident in its vibrant arts scene and community gatherings. A prominent landmark is Bays Mountain Park, offering panoramic views and a sanctuary for local wildlife, a testament to the area's commitment to preserving its natural heritage.
